Movie showing Audrey Enevoldson visiting Denmark in 1978.
This very short movie shows Audrey Enevoldson visiting the homestead in Denmark where her Father was born. The visit appears to have taken place in June 1978. I think Krista Veise, Audrey's cousin is also in the movie and possibly other relatives. It is interesting to see the old homestead which was recently renovated. The homestead in 1978 seems to be still very isolated whereas today it is surrounded by modern houses in the middle of a housing estate.
Vardo
Vardø is the eastern most town in Norway and the Nordic countries, east of Saint Petersburg, Kiev and Istanbul. The eastern part of Finnmark is in the same time zone as the rest of the country, even if it is more than an hour at odds with daylight hours.
The port of Vardø, on the Barents Sea, remains ice-free all year round thanks to the effect of the warm North Atlantic drift. Vardø is usually referred to as Norway's only mainland town in the Arctic climate zone, although this is not strictly correct since the town is located on an island about 2 kilometres (1 mi) off the northeastern coast of the Varanger Peninsula. In July, the 24-hr average temperature is only 9.1 °C (48 °F), while the January average is a modest −5.1 °C (23 °F).
